Applicants must meet the following requirements :
- Bachelors’ degree in Construction Management, Port, Civil or Coastal Engineering or relevant fields
- 10 years’ general working experience with at least 5 years’ experience in port construction projects
- PrEng will be advantageous
- Track record of successfully implementing port projects
Specific professional experience :
5 years’ professional experience in the construction of large (above EUR 15m equivalent) marine infrastructure projects, with strong preference for port development, maritime works including dredging and / or reclamation as well as transport logistic platforms (preferably in ports), and including works implemented under FIDIC General Conditions of Contract.The project works would form part of port expansion project that typically comprise of dredging and reclamation, a quay wall and apron, terminal yard and buildings.The Construction Project Manager will be required to oversee and coordinate the management of the various FIDIC construction contracts but will not be responsible for administration of the contracts.Ensure project compliance with the applicable codes, practices, policies, performance standards and specifications.Position
